Assembly House Single Espresso: Our favorite single origin coffee for espresso

Price: £10 | Buy now from Assembly Coffee

Assembly Coffee is a roastery located in Brixton, London. Their House Single Espresso showcases their meticulous attention to detail in every step of the coffee-making process.

This particular blend was created in collaboration with the cafes and restaurants that Assembly serves. It is specifically designed to excel as both an espresso and with milk. The Red Bourbon beans used in this blend are grown and processed on the Finca Las Brumas farm in El Salvador, nestled in the Cordillera Del Balsalmo.

The flavor profile of this coffee is truly mouth-watering. You'll experience the taste of ripe peaches and baked green apples, enhanced with notes of dates, pear, and honey. When the grind and dosage are just right, the resulting espresso lives up to its reputation. When mixed with milk, the flavors of dates, pears, and honey become more prominent, creating a truly delicious cup of coffee.

Type: Single Origin, dark roast; Varietal: Red Bourbon; Area of origin: Cordillera Del Balsalmo, El Salvador; Weight options: 200g, 1kg

Kiss the Hippo, Mellow and Balanced: An easy-going single origin option

Price: £12.50 (250g) | Buy now from Amazon

Kiss the Hippo is a renowned coffee roastery located in Richmond, London. They offer a variety of blends and single origin coffees that are highly regarded within the coffee enthusiast community and independent coffee shops.

Their Mellow and Balanced beans come from the foothills of the Andes in Los Vascos, Colombia. They are cultivated by a number of smallholders who reside in the region. This particular coffee boasts an enticing flavor profile with hints of caramel, honey, and green apple. The omni-roast makes it a versatile choice for both espresso and filter brewing methods.

At £12.50 for 250g, this may not be an everyday coffee for everyone. However, if you're new to specialty coffees, it's worth exploring smaller bags to find the flavors that suit your taste. When purchased directly from the Kiss the Hippo website, you can also get a 1kg bag for £37.50, though a delivery fee of £3.40 applies.

Type: Single Origin, omni-roast; Varietal: Caturra, Colombia, Castillo; Area of origin: Los Vascos, Colombia; Weight options: 250g

Rounton Coffee Roasters El Salvador Bosque Lya: The best affordable single origin coffee beans

Price: £22.50 (1kg) | Buy now from Amazon

Rounton Coffee Roasters offers a range of coffees through Amazon and their own website. This single origin coffee hails from the foothills of the Santa Ana volcano in El Salvador. Specifically, it comes from the Finca Bosque Lya farm where farmer Joe Melina cultivates the Bourbon varietal across the expansive 96-hectare estate.

The medium roast of these beans makes them suitable for both espresso and filter brewing methods. When properly ground and dosed, you'll savor the tasting notes of plum, milk chocolate, and hazelnut in delightful cappuccinos and lattes.

While this coffee may not possess the complexity or exotic flavors of more expensive single origin options, it serves as an excellent choice for those seeking a rich and smooth classic coffee that far surpasses most supermarket offerings. With next-day delivery included for Prime members, it's the perfect option for restocking your coffee supply when running low.

Type: Single Origin, medium roast; Varietal: Bourbon, Area of origin: El Salvador; Weight options: 1kg

Volcano Coffee Works Decaf: The Finest Decaffeinated Coffee Beans

Price: £9 (200g) / £32 (1kg) | Purchase now from Volcano Coffee Works

Volcano Coffee Works, located in Brixton, London, is a responsible coffee roastery that offers an exceptional decaffeinated blend. It is the perfect choice for those seeking to reduce their caffeine consumption while still enjoying a delicious cup of coffee.

Volcano sources its beans from the ACPC Pinchanaki Cooperative, which comprises of 330 producers based in Central Peru's Junin region. Unlike cheaper decaf coffees that use solvent-based processes, this blend undergoes a chemical-free CO2 decaffeination process, ensuring its quality.

When it comes to flavor, decaffeinated coffee often involves a compromise due to the necessary decaffeination methods. However, Volcano's decaf blend surpasses expectations, whether brewed as a filter coffee, in a quick cafetiere, or as an espresso shot. The discernible tasting notes of praline, muscovado, and cacao create a delightful and indulgent experience with every cup.

Type: Blend, omni-roast; Varietal: Arabica; Area of origin: Junin, Peru; Weight options: 200g, 1kg
